PhyWhisperer-USB is a hardware USB sniffer & triggering platform that allows users to test the security of USB devices using side-channel power analysis and fault injection using a Python 3 interface, beside simply capturing packets. This has become especially important now as some USB devices include Bitcoin Wallets, FIDO2 keys, and encrypted drives with valuable data. PhyWhisperer-USB hardware specifications: FPGA – Xilinx Spartan 7S15 with 12,800 logic cells USB USB 2.0 Low/Full/High Speed mode PC connection – Micro-USB 2.0 HS port Host connection – Micro-USB port Target connection – USB-A female connector Trigger pattern – 1 – 64 bytes with mask Trigger delay – 0 – 1048576 cycles of 240 MHz internal clock derived from USB clock USB sniffer FIFO – 8192 bytes (FPGA block RAM, adjustable depending on FPGA utilization) Expansion – Spare digital I/O: 8 data pins, 1 clock pin routed to FPGA (on front panel) Clock output […]
AAEON Launches BOXER-8150AI Compact Embedded Box PC Features 8 USB 3.0 Ports
The new compact embedded solutions’ addition to the BOXER-8100AI family is specially designed for artificial intelligence (AI) support. According to its makers, AAEON, it has a configuration of eight USB 3.0 ports made available through four USB controllers chips. This makes it perfect for a wide range of computer vision applications, some of which are visual inspection, quality control, and facial recognition. Now, each USB chip controls a pair of USB 3.0 ports. By dedicating one chip to one pair of ports, each chip handles less data traffic overall. This also improves bandwidth from connected devices and allows the BOXER-8150AI to maximize speeds and framerates of AI image processing. The product is currently in stock and available for purchase on AAEON online store for $1,142.00. Key Features of BOXER-8150AI Nvidia TX2 Module HMP Dual Denver 2 + Quad ARM A57 8GB LPDDR4 32GB eMMC 5.1 HDMI 2.0 8x USB […]
$10 Is it me or is it is just USB? Board Quickly Tests your USB Cables
USB 2.0 and 1.1 cables are supposed to come with four signal: GND and 5V for power, and D-/D+ for data. Some chargers come with cables without the data cables. It may “work” for charging, but if for some reasons you decided to use that USB cable for tasks requiring data this won’t work, and you may not find out easily the reason at first. Importantly the data lines can also be used during charging to request more power from the host device, so if they are missing slower charging may ensue. You could always use a multimeter to check your cables, but “iUSB cable testers it me or is it just USB? ” board provides a simpler and faster solution by indicating which wires are connected in your cable with LEDs. The developer, named nerfhammer, separate cables with and without data lines as follows: Basic USB cables cannot transfer […]
Programmable USB Hub Power Adjustable with Built-In Dev Board (Crowdfunding)
Capable Robot Components has launched its Crowd Supply campaign for the Programmable USB Hub in June of 2019. The hub is a feature rich and component rich USB hub that has a dev board built-in. The entire system is housed in an extruded aluminum case, with all the numbering and lettering and port attachments in brilliant white. Control power and data flow, directly through the unit. The first 40 units are sold out. There seem to be good reasons why these USB Hubs sell out fast. There was an in-depth article written on a similar hub some time ago. Inside the enclosure is an array of functionality packed neatly onto a small board. There are 4x USB 2.0 ports that are High-Speed downstream ports and 1x upstream port, a 5th endpoint on the USB hub exposes 2 12C buses via Sparkfun Qwiic connectors, the UART and 2X GPIO. The input power is […]
New Raspberry Pi 4 VLI Firmware Lowers Temperature by 3-5°C
The other day I tested Raspberry Pi 4 with an heatsink since previous multi-threaded benchmarks clearly made the board throttle when running those without any cooling solution. The guys at the Raspberry Pi Foundation somehow noticed my post, and I received an email from Eben Upton explaining a new Raspberry Pi 4 VLI firmware had “some thermal optimizations that are not installed by default on early production units.” I did not understand VLI at first, but eventually understood this referred to the firmware for VIA VL805 PCIe USB 3.0 controller on the board. The Raspberry Pi Foundation provided me with a test version of the firmware, which they’ll release in the next few days, or weeks after testing is completed. Now if you’re going to test a platform that will throttle due to overheating, it’s very important you do so at constant room temperature. I work in a office where […]
MINIX NEO S1 & S2 Combine SSD and USB-C Hub into a Single Device
MINIX has sold accessories for mini PCs for a little while, and last year I wrote a short review for MINIX NEO C Plus USB-C adapter with dual HDMI output, Ethernet, USB ports, and microSD and SD card slots. The company is apparently about to launch two new USB-C hubs that come with built-in SSD storage. MINIX NEO S1 & S2 USB-C hub include respectively a 120GB and 240GB SSD, and while they are not yet listed on MINIX website, GearBest is offering the two new accessories for $84.99 and $97.99 with shipping scheduled for early July. MINIX NEO S1/S2 specifications: Storage – Built-in 120GB or 240GB SSD storage up to 415MB/s read speed and 400MB/s write speed Video Output – HDMI up to 4K @ 30Hz USB – 2x USB 3.0 ports, USB-C port for power delivery only, USB-C cable to connect to laptop, computer or board. Misc – […]
Geniatech A683 is an ATSC 3.0 USB TV Tuner
ATSC (Advanced Television Systems Committee) is the standard used in North American, and some other countries around the world such as South Korea, for digital terrestrial television that allows you to receive free-to-air or paid channels over an indoor or outdoor antenna. ATSC 3.0 is the very latest version of the standard with new features including “H.265/HEVC for video channels of up to 2160p 4K resolution at 120 frames per second, wide color gamut, high dynamic range, Dolby AC-4 and MPEG-H 3D Audio, datacasting capabilities, and more robust mobile television support” (Source: Wikipedia). The first deployments occurred in South Korea in May 2017, but it’s unclear where the US is at the moment, and it seems there were some broadcast tests in 2018, but not full deployments. Nevertheless, if you want to watch or record programs in ATSC 3.0 channels, you’ll need new hardware, and currently most TVs won’t ship […]
Silicon Motion SM3282 is a Single Chip Solution for Portable USB SSD Sticks
Portable USB SSD drives are nothing new, but they are usually implemented using a stand-alone SSD with its own SSD controller combined with a USB to SATA or PCIe bridge chip in order to interface the SSD drive with the host computer or board. Silicon Motion has recently unveiled SM3282 SSD controller that also comes with an on-chip USB 3.2 Gen 1 interface providing a complete single-chip hardware and software solution for portable USB SSD sticks. This should enable smaller and cheaper USB SSD drives. Some of the key features of the SM3282 controller include: Peak sequential read and write transfer speeds of over 400MB/sec Supports USB 3.2 Gen 1 type A and type C Crystal-less design for bill-of-materials cost savings Built-in 3.3V/2.5V/1.8V/1.2V voltage regulators Supports LED for indicating access status 68-pin QFN package Compatible with Windows 10, Mac OS 10.x and Linux kernel v2.4 and greater The chip also […]